What is the road-map plan for AL State Overtime Pay State Income Tax Exemption starting 01-JAN-2024

Oracle EBS Payroll, 12.2.11 version.

We have find below note on Alabama State website about 'Alabama State Overtime Pay State Income Tax Exemption rules starting 01-JAN-2024', hence reaching out to Oracle Support to understand the payroll impact, and the road-map plan for the new amended AL tax rules.

https://www.revenue.alabama.gov/individual-corporate/overtime-exemption

For the tax year beginning on or after January 1, 2024, overtime pay received by a full-time hourly wage paid employee for hours worked above 40 in any given week are excluded from gross income and therefore exempt from Alabama state income tax. Tied with this exemption are employer reporting requirements to ALDOR. Employers are required to report the total aggregate amount of overtime paid and the total number employees who received overtime pay.
